Abstract
The invention relates to an insecticidal composite which includes chlorantraniliprole belonging to anthranilic diamides insecticides and at least one compound selected from organic phosphorus insecticide: chlorpyrifos, quinalphos, profenofos and triazophos. The composite can be processed into water emulsions water dispersible granules micro-capsules and suspending agents. Field experiments on different control objects are conducted, the results show that the insecticidal composite has high insecticidal efficiency and wide control range, and can effectively control main pests such as rice stem borers, rice planthoppers, beet armyworms, diamondback moths and the like harmful to multiple crops.

Background technology
Rynaxypyr:
Rynaxypyr is a kind of new drug of du pont company exploitation, and is environmentally safe, to the little poison of aquatile, honeybee and people.Its insecticidal mechanism is by activating the ryania acceptor in the insect muscle, cause the internal calcium ion unrestrictedly to discharge, stop contraction of muscle, thereby make insect stop to get food rapidly, muscular paralysis, vigor disappearance, paralysis occurring, until thorough death.Insect eats paralysis from getting, and stops harm, only needs about 7 minutes time.Rynaxypyr can be prevented and treated multiple lepidoptera pest, and especially the insect to conventional pesticide generation resistance has special efficacy.In China, because Rynaxypyr import price height, therefore peasant's drug cost height can not use in the crop pests control widely.
Organophosphorous pesticide of the present invention, comprise chlopyrifos, quinalphos, Profenofos, Hostathion etc., main insecticidal mechanism is: suppressing in the insect bodies is that " acetylcholinesterase (AChE) " or " cholinesterase " activity (ChE) in the nerve destroyed normal nerve impulse conduction, causes a series of poisoning symptoms of insect and arrive death.
Active ingredient Rynaxypyr and organophosphorous pesticide are composite, and the two mechanism of action difference can be complementary.
Chlopyrifos: O, O-diethyl-O-3,5,6-trichloro-2-pyridyl phosphorothionate is a kind of broad-spectrum organic insecticide, and its mechanism of action is an acetylcholine esterase inhibition, have tag, stomach toxicity and stifling three kinds of modes of action, insecticidal spectrum is wide, toxicity is lower, is one of main insecticide of control grain, fruit tree, vegetables and other economic crops insect pest, to user's safety.
Quinalphos: O, O-diethyl-O-(2-diethquinalphione) thiophosphate has desinsection, acaricidal action, have stomach toxicity and action of contace poison, do not inhale and stifling performance in not having, good penetration is arranged on plant, certain ovicidal action is arranged, and degradation speed is fast on plant, and the longevity of residure is short.Be applicable to the control of various pests on paddy rice, cotton, fruit tree, the vegetables.
Profenofos: Profenofos is a broad-spectrum organophosphorous pesticide, is a kind of anticholinesterase, have tag, stomach poison function and interior absorption, be mainly used in the lepidoptera pest of control paddy rice, cotton and vegetable field, degraded easily in environment.
Hostathion: Hostathion is a kind of broad-spectrum organophosphorous pesticide, miticide, has strong tagging and stomach poison function, good disinsection effect, and ovicidal action is obvious, and permeability is stronger, no systemic action.Be used for various crop such as paddy rice and prevent and treat various pests.Be mainly used in the lepidoptera pest on control paddy rice, fruit tree, cotton and the grain class crop.
Summary of the invention
The object of the present invention is to provide a kind of component reasonable, have the complex preparation of notable synergistic effect, and can produce high insecticidal effect, drug cost is low, and can delay the resistance of insecticide.Technical scheme of the present invention is as follows:
A kind of Pesticidal combination is characterized in that, comprises two active components.First active ingredient is to activate calcium release channel in blue Buddhist nun's alkali recipient cell, causes storing the O-formammidotiazol-benzamide insecticide Rynaxypyr of the property out of control release of calcium ion; The second active component B is a kind of organophosphorus insecticides, and wherein organophosphorus insecticide is a kind of of chlopyrifos, quinalphos, Profenofos and Hostathion.
Must the measuring than being 3~70 of the first active component Rynaxypyr and the second active component B in the Pesticidal combination: 5~80, be preferably 8~30: 5~40.The formulation that insecticides of the present invention can be prepared according to the known method of those skilled in the art of the present technique is missible oil, aqueous emulsion, water-dispersible granules, microcapsule formulations and suspending agent.
One of technical scheme of the present invention, described Pesticidal combination are cream preparation, and the percentage by weight of component is:
Rynaxypyr 3~70%
Active ingredient B 5~80%
Conventional emulsifier 10~30%
Conventional solvent 20~50%
Conventional synergist 1~5%
The concrete production stage of this cream preparation adds emulsifier, the synergist back that stirs after the dissolving fully again and becomes the oily liquids of transparent and homogeneous for earlier Rynaxypyr, active ingredient B being added in the solvent, can promptly makes the cream preparation that contains the Rynaxypyr Pesticidal combination of the present invention.
Two of technical scheme of the present invention, described Pesticidal combination are aqueous emulsion, and the percentage by weight of component is:
Rynaxypyr 3~70%
Active ingredient B 5~80%
Emulsifier 3~30%
Solvent 5~15%
Antimicrobial 0.1~1%
Stabilizing agent 2~15%
Antifreezing agent 2~5%
Defoamer 0.1~8%
Thickener 0.2~2%
Water surplus
The concrete production stage of this aqueous emulsion is: at first former medicine Rynaxypyr is added with active ingredient B, solvent and emulsifier, cosolvent and be in the same place, make and be dissolved into uniform oil phase; With part water, antifreeze, other insecticides adjuvant such as antimicrobial mixes into uniform water; When the reactor high speed stirs, oil phase is added water, slowly add water, open clipper and carry out high speed shear, and add remaining water, shear half an hour approximately, form the aqueous emulsion of oil-in-water type until reaching the phase inversion point.Promptly make the aqueous emulsion that contains the Rynaxypyr Pesticidal combination.
Three of technical scheme of the present invention, described Pesticidal combination are water dispersible granules, and the percentage by weight of component is:
Rynaxypyr 3~70%,
Active ingredient B 5~80%
Dispersant 3~10%
Wetting agent 1~10%
Disintegrant 1~5%
The filler surplus.
The concrete production stage of this water dispersible granules is: by above-mentioned prescription Rynaxypyr, active ingredient B and dispersant, wetting agent, disintegrant and filler are mixed, pulverize with micro jet, through mediating, add then and carry out granulation, drying, screening in the fluidized bed prilling dryer after sample analysis makes the water dispersible granules that contains the Rynaxypyr Pesticidal combination of the present invention.
Four of technical scheme of the present invention, described Pesticidal combination are microcapsule formulations, and the percentage by weight of component is:
Rynaxypyr 3~70%
Active ingredient B 5~80%
Urea 5~20%
Formaldehyde 10~30%
Emulsifying dispersant 5~20%
Antifreezing agent 1~5%
Thickener 0.1~2%
Antimicrobial 0.1~1%
Stabilizing agent 2~15%
Defoamer 0.1~0.8%
Water surplus
In the there-necked flask of agitating device is housed, add urea and formaldehyde (amount of substance ratio be about 1: 1.5~2.0), about pH value to 8~9, be warming up to 70~80 ℃ then, react and obtain stable urea resin prepolymer with the sodium hydroxide solution regulator solution.The former medicine of getting a certain amount of Rynaxypyr and active ingredient B is dissolved in the cyclohexane, and adds emulsifying dispersant in solution, follows vigorous stirring, and being made into the aqueous solution that contains emulsifying dispersant is the O/W type stable emulsion of water.Above-mentioned urea resin prepolymer is added in the emulsion, regulate the pH value, polymerization reaction take place under the acid catalysis condition is wrapped oil phase substance, forms microcapsule granule.Slowly heat up, solidify, temperature is controlled at 40~50 ℃, hardening time 1h.Select to add an amount of auxiliary agent, the microcapsule suspending agent that gets final product stablely.
Five of technical scheme of the present invention, described Pesticidal combination are suspending agent, and the percentage by weight of component is:
Rynaxypyr 3~70%
Active ingredient B 5~80%
Dispersant 5~20%
Antifreezing agent 1~5%
Stabilizing agent 2~15%
Thickener 0.1~2%
Defoamer 0.1~0.8%
Water surplus
The concrete production stage of this suspending agent is earlier other auxiliary agents to be mixed, mix through high speed shear, add Rynaxypyr and active ingredient B, abrading-ball is 2~3 hours in ball crusher, make a diameter all below 5mm, make the suspending agent preparation that contains the Rynaxypyr Pesticidal combination of the present invention.
